The Markup Design and Scripting: A Simple Guide to Digital Building

Wiki Article

Getting going with web development might seem complex at first, but it's actually quite manageable when you learn the fundamentals. This article will introduce you to the essential technologies that power the internet : HTML, CSS, and JavaScript. HTML is used for structuring the content of a site, defining headings, paragraphs, graphics, and links . CSS then handles the visual presentation , controlling things like colors, fonts, and layout . Finally, JavaScript provides interactivity and responsiveness to your website , allowing for things like animations and visitor interactions. Learning these fundamental languages is the first step in your journey to becoming a online developer!

Perfecting CSS: Tips and Hacks for Stunning Websites

To design truly impressive online experiences, understanding CSS is completely essential. Past the basics, delve into advanced techniques like CSS variables for enhanced maintainability and organized systems. Play with layout for adaptive designs that gracefully work on various screens. Avoid neglecting specificity; a thorough knowledge will save you headaches in the future. Finally, explore using CSS tools like Sass or Less to increase your output and write more advanced styles.

Web DevelopmentSiteOnline Fundamentals: YourMyA FirstInitialBeginning ProgrammingCodingDevelopment ProjectsTasksAssignments

To truly graspunderstandmaster web developmentsite creationonline building, it's essentialvitalcrucial to startbeginlaunch with simplebasicintroductory programming projectsassignmentsexercises. ConsiderThink aboutImagine building a personalsmallbasic portfoliowebsitepage to showcasedisplaypresent yourthesome skills. Alternatively, tryattemptbuild a to-dotaskchecklist applicationprogramtool – this helpsassistsguides youthe userdevelopers to learndiscoverpractice fundamentalcorekey concepts like HTMLmarkupstructure, CSSstylingvisuals, and JavaScriptscriptingcoding for interactivityfunctionalitybehavior. These earlyfirstbeginner endeavors provideoffergive valuableimportantsignificant experience and boostincreaseimprove yourthea confidence as youdevelopersprogrammers progressadvancemove further intotowardsalong the fieldarearealm of web designsite constructiononline development.

Structure and Recommended Guidelines for Current Platforms

A structured HTML structure is vital for developing up-to-date websites. Focusing on semantic HTML5 elements like navigation, body, section, and base enhances both accessibility and visibility. Using a clear document outline ensures that the content is readily parsed by applications and indexes. Moreover, adhering to established coding practices—such as correct indentation, clear comments, and valid HTML – results in a more manageable and robust website. Evaluate the following:

A Programming Journey: Transitioning Static Markup and Interactive Online Apps

The initial phase of web creation often begins with Markup, a core tool for creating the underlying structure of a page. However, to truly create a current online experience, a shift to responsive web sites is necessary. This involves acquiring coding languages such as ECMAScript, Python, or Java, permitting for visitor experience and data management. The endeavor is a rewarding opportunity to broaden your expertise, moving past static content presentation and to a realm of possibilities.

CSS Layout Techniques: Crafting Adaptive and Beautiful Layouts

Achieving truly adaptable and attractive web interfaces copyrights on utilizing various CSS structure techniques. Traditional methods like absolute positioning are often insufficient for contemporary web development . Instead, explore innovative here approaches like Flexbox, offering remarkable control over element arrangement and distribution; Grid, ideal for sophisticated two-dimensional arrangements; and more recent techniques utilizing custom values and adaptive styling to ensure your application looks amazing across a wide range of devices . Adopting these strategies is vital for a impactful online experience.

Report this wiki page